An enterprise operates a hybrid architecture where on-premises workloads communicate with Compute Engine instances in a Google Cloud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) over Cloud VPN. After recent network updates, on-premises clients report complete connection failures when attempting to reach the internal IP address of a backend application VM on TCP port 8443.
You need to systematically isolate the root cause of the connectivity failure within Google Cloud to determine whether the packet loss is caused by VPC firewall rules, Cloud Router configuration, or VPC routing.
What should you do?
Connectivity Tests is a diagnostic and static configuration analysis tool within Network Intelligence Center. It simulates the expected forwarding path of a packet through your VPC network, Cloud VPN tunnels, VLAN attachments, and VPC Network Peering connections based on an abstract state machine model of Google Cloud networking.
8443.Using Connectivity Tests provides immediate, visual root-cause diagnostics for hybrid-to-cloud connection failures by checking routes and firewall configurations in a single step.
